Fig. 4: Auditory threat conditioning is modulated by auditory association cortex neurons projecting to SNL.

From: Corticonigral projections recruit substantia nigra pars lateralis dopaminergic neurons for auditory threat memories

Fig. 4

a Illustration showing infection strategy with 2 viral injections: Retrograde AAV9-Cre in SNL, followed by AAV-DIO-eGFP or AAV-DIO-eGFP-TetTx in AuV/TeA. b Representative brightfield and fluorescence images showing the extent of viral infection in AuV/TeA/SNL. c Behavioral paradigm used for FM auditory threat conditioning. d–f Graphs showing average % freeze for habituation, conditioning, and retrieval phases. Squared symbols represent average % freeze during FM tone trains (control, N = 8; TetTx, N = 6). Whisker bars are ± SEM. g Average % freeze during FM tones for control (eGFP, N = 8, gray) and treated (TetTx, N = 6, red) mice. Square symbols represent averages from a single mouse. Two-way ANOVA showed significant treatment (p = 0.012), but not phase (p = 0.60), or phase-treatment interaction (p = 0.36). Sidak’s post-hoc test revealed a significant difference between groups during retrieval (p = 0.02). h Behavioral paradigm used for simple tones auditory threat conditioning. i–k Graph showing average % freeze for habituation/conditioning, retrieval, and contextual phases. Squared symbols represent the freeze average during a single pure tone for habituation/conditioning and retrieval (control, N = 8; TetTx, N = 8). Whisker bars are ± SEM. l Average % freeze during simple tones for control (eGFP, N = 8, gray) and treated (TetTx, N = 8, red) mice. Every squared symbol represents the average from a single mouse. Two-way ANOVA showed significant treatment (p = 0.0398), but not phase (p = 0.51), or phase-treatment interaction (p = 0.98). Average % freeze resulted significantly different between control and treated mice for Contextual Freezing (p = 0.048, Mann-Whitney). Box whiskers represent 25–75% percentiles, solid squares are mean value, horizontal box lines represent medians. *p < 0.05, **p < 0.01, ***p < 0.001, ****p < 0.0001.
